加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(http://www.zzredu.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

MySQL优化与跨语言连接实战

发布时间:2025-12-19 13:04:04 所属栏目:MySql教程 来源:DaWei
导读:  作为小程序原生开发工程师,我们在实际项目中经常会遇到数据库性能瓶颈的问题。尤其是在高并发场景下,MySQL的查询效率直接影响到用户体验和系统稳定性。2025建议图AI生成,仅供参考  优化MySQL的核心在于理解

  作为小程序原生开发工程师,我们在实际项目中经常会遇到数据库性能瓶颈的问题。尤其是在高并发场景下,MySQL的查询效率直接影响到用户体验和系统稳定性。


2025建议图AI生成,仅供参考

  优化MySQL的核心在于理解其执行计划。通过EXPLAIN关键字分析SQL语句的执行路径,可以发现索引是否被正确使用,是否存在全表扫描等问题。合理设计索引是提升查询速度的关键,但也要避免过度索引导致写入性能下降。


  在跨语言连接方面,我们需要确保不同编程语言与MySQL的交互方式一致。例如,在Node.js中使用mysql模块时,要注意连接池的配置;而在Java中使用JDBC时,需要处理好事务和连接复用问题。保持连接的高效性和稳定性是跨语言协作的基础。


  同时,我们还需要关注数据库连接的超时设置和重连机制。特别是在微服务架构中,多个服务可能共享同一个数据库实例,合理的连接管理能有效减少资源浪费和连接泄漏的风险。


  在实际开发中,建议将数据库操作封装成独立的服务层,并通过接口进行调用。这样不仅便于维护,还能在后续扩展时更灵活地切换数据库类型或引入缓存机制。


  定期对慢查询日志进行分析,可以帮助我们发现潜在的性能问题。通过优化这些慢查询,可以显著提升整体系统的响应速度。


  站长个人见解,MySQL优化和跨语言连接是小程序开发中不可忽视的部分。只有深入理解数据库原理,并结合实际项目需求进行调整,才能构建出高效、稳定的后端系统。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章